pyspark.pandas.Series.rename_axis¶
-
係列。
rename_axis
( 映射器:可選(任何]=沒有一個,指數:可選(任何]=沒有一個,原地:bool=假 )→可選(pyspark.pandas.series.Series] ¶ -
設置軸為索引或列的名稱。
- 參數
-
- 映射器、索引 標量,類似,dict-like或功能,可選的
-
一個標量,類似dict-like或函數轉換適用於索引值。
- 原地 bool,默認的錯誤
-
直接修改對象,而不是創建一個新的係列。
- 返回
-
- 係列,或者沒有如果原地是真的。
另請參閱
-
Series.rename
-
修改索引標簽或係列的名字。
-
DataFrame.rename
-
改變DataFrame索引標簽或名字。
-
Index.rename
-
設置新名稱索引。
例子
> > >年代=ps。係列([“狗”,“貓”,“猴子”),的名字=“動物”)> > >年代0的狗1隻貓2隻猴子名稱:動物,dtype:對象> > >年代。rename_axis(“指數”)。sort_index()指數0的狗1隻貓2隻猴子名稱:動物,dtype:對象
MultiIndex
> > >指數=pd。MultiIndex。from_product([[“哺乳動物”),…(“狗”,“貓”,“猴子”]],…的名字=(“類型”,“名字”])> > >年代=ps。係列([4,4,2),指數=指數,的名字=“num_legs”)> > >年代類型名稱哺乳動物狗4貓4猴子2名稱:num_legs dtype: int64> > >年代。rename_axis(指數={“類型”:“類”})。sort_index()類名哺乳動物貓4狗4猴子2名稱:num_legs dtype: int64> > >年代。rename_axis(指數=str。上)。sort_index()類型名稱哺乳動物貓4狗4猴子2名稱:num_legs dtype: int64